About the role

The Impact of Freelance Trainers in Modern Organizations

Freelance trainers design and deliver targeted learning programs that bridge critical skills gaps within corporate teams. They analyze educational needs, translate complex technical or behavioral concepts into actionable lessons, and facilitate workshops that drive employee performance. By bringing in external expertise, organizations accelerate onboarding, successfully adopt new technologies, and foster a culture of continuous professional development.

Key Areas of Training Specialization

  • Technical and IT system rollouts, including ERP and CRM software training
  • Agile frameworks, Scrum practices, and product management methodologies
  • Leadership development, executive coaching, and communication skills
  • Compliance, safety protocols, and regulatory standard instruction
  • Sales techniques, customer service excellence, and onboarding workflows

Essential Skills of a Professional Trainer

Outstanding corporate trainers possess a blend of instructional design expertise, strong public speaking skills, and deep subject-matter knowledge. They must be adept at reading group dynamics, adapting their delivery style to different learning speeds, and using modern learning management systems (LMS) or virtual collaboration tools. Their ability to measure training effectiveness through concrete feedback loops ensures long-term retention.

When to Engage an External Training Expert

Companies typically hire freelance instructors during major transitions, such as migrating to new software databases, restructuring departments, or launching leadership initiatives. An external specialist brings objective perspectives, up-to-date industry best practices, and the agility to scale training quickly without taxing internal HR resources. This approach guarantees that training is highly focused, high-impact, and completed within the project timeline.

While an agile trainer focuses on teaching structured frameworks, Scrum principles, and defined methodologies, an agile coach works long-term to guide team behavior and cultural transformation. Trainers deliver structured lessons with specific educational milestones, whereas coaches facilitate ongoing organizational change.
